2003 Mazda Protege5 - overheating

My radiator overflow keeps emptying and the rad overheating. I have replaced the water pump, thermostat, and most belts. If there is a leak in the radiator, I sure can’t find it. There is no water in the oil, which would lead me to believe that the head is not cracked or blown. What could it be? HELP.

Might be like same problem I had one time there was a small hole in one of the hose’s that would only leak while driving did not leak after shutdown.

Remove the radiator cap when the engine is cold.

Start the engine, and as the engine idles watch the coolant in the radiator.

If bubbles begin appearing in the coolant, the engine has a blown head gasket.